Mobula Rays

Mobula Rays

The mobula rays visit us during the summer in the Azores and we can have close encounters with them at Princess Alice Seamount Bank, 45 nautical miles southwest off Faial. The gracious rays swim very fast, and yet, they often come around and slowly swim nearby to take a close look. Photos by Patrick Masse
